Transaction 7595e110f90e942f640b1924e693e9dd26795d856b66c78eb8e08b0c1157e0d8
1 Input
1 Output
-
7595e110f90e942f640b1924e693e9dd26795d856b66c78eb8e08b0c1157e0d8:0
- value
- 10744722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4f7fcac4a218b094f33a78f84c5c1c18d0bbeb6 OP_EQUAL
- address
- 3NZh4iiyr5S5PiSeco67RXiJdzgKuevZsQ